538291c03f
- Unify buildClaudeCodeSystemMessage implementation in shared package - Refactor MessagesService to provide comprehensive message processing API - Extract streaming logic, error handling, and header preparation into service methods - Remove duplicate anthropic config from renderer, use shared implementation - Update ClaudeCodeService to use append mode for custom instructions - Improve type safety and request validation in message processing